Waterfalls with no hike required!! Pisgah National Forest, Brevard, NC
These falls can easily be seen all in one trip. You can also add Moore Cove, Log Hollow Branch, and/or Daniels Ridge Falls for some shorter hikes mixed in.
Looking Glass Falls
Parking on the side of the road, a few stairs down to the viewing platform. You can walk around in the water and on the rocks here. Usually quite a few people here because the ease of getting to it.
Sliding Rock
This is exactly what it sounds like - a giant rock that you can slide down. In the summer, you have to pay to park and sometimes there is a life guard on duty during peak times. Again, this one gets VERY crowded - try to go during the week or spring/fall.
Slick Rock Falls
You can see this one from the road. You can also, VERY CAREFULLY walk up and behind the falls - especially if there are nice people there to help you :)
